Uber Launches In-App Bengaluru Metro Tickets with UPI Payments and Live Updates

Bengaluru residents now have an easier way to buy Namma Metro tickets, as Uber has added a new feature to its app. People can purchase Metro tickets directly through the Uber app, making travel smoother and more convenient. The ticket payment can be made using UPI, which speeds up the

Uber Direct in Bengaluru

Along with metro ticketing, Uber has also introduced its business-to-business delivery service, Uber Direct, in Bengaluru. This service is designed to help businesses manage deliveries more efficiently. Initially, Uber Direct will focus on delivering groceries, and it has been launched in partnership with the Open Network for Digital Commerce (ONDC). Uber's India and South Asia President has said that the company wants to provide a simple plug-and-play system so that businesses can easily use Uber's large logistics network.

Live Metro Updates on Uber App

The Uber app will now also show live metro updates, allowing commuters to get real-time information about train timings and plan their trips better. With this new integration, the overall metro travel experience is expected to improve. Uber has also mentioned that drivers using the platform can join the Uber Direct programme. This could give them additional earning opportunities beyond regular ride bookings.
Moreover, Uber is exploring the idea of launching its Uber Shuttle service in Bengaluru. This service is already running successfully in cities like Delhi and Kolkata and offers comfortable shuttle rides on fixed routes.

Bengaluru Metro's Upgraded Service

Meanwhile, the Bangalore Metro Rail Corporation Limited (BMRCL) is also working on major service upgrades. In the next two years, BMRCL aims to increase the frequency of trains to every four minutes on all metro lines. This move is expected to reduce waiting times, encourage more people to use the metro, and make daily travel faster and more reliable.
